    "We're rarities, you know that?" "We?" "People like you and me. People who can figure out how to live out here, alone, free. Or not just how to live, but how to thrive." "I'm not sure I'd call this thriving, Addy. Not until you get a fire going." ... Adelene Fitz wants to disappear. But that's nearly impossible for her. She has a family to take care of, a name and a reputation to uphold, a complicated life to keep up with. Disappearing is out of the question. But sometimes she wonders if she can leave it all behind. ... Eliot Ward wants to be found, but not by someone else. He needs to discover his own mind, and staple down all the loose edges. He wants peace and quiet in his head, to drown out every other sound but the pounding of his drums. He needs a break from his hectic world, to find himself in a mess of jumbled thoughts. But being lost might just be the solution. ... Two teens, at odds with the world. They must learn, not only how to live, but how to thrive. But first, they have to figure out how to build a fire.
